Longview Park
The Longview Park Pickleball Court in Carrollton, Georgia offers an amazing pickleball experience. It has 6 permanent indoor and outdoor courts made of asphalt with lights for nighttime play. Players can access the court free of charge and make use of the lighted courts to practice their skills.

Frequently Asked Questions
Can I reserve a court at Longview Park?
No, the courts at Longview Park are available on a first-come, first-served basis. Reservations are not required or accepted. This system ensures that everyone has an equal opportunity to play and enjoy the park. However, during peak hours or tournaments, there may be a waiting list to rotate players and ensure fair play.
Are the pickleball courts at Longview Park open all year round?
Yes, the pickleball courts at Longview Park are open year-round, weather permitting. They are designed for outdoor play and do not have any covers or enclosures.
